PDP Locks Civil Secretariat in Srinagar

By Agence India Press Bureau Report

Srinagar: The opposition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) Thursday locked the gates of civil secretariat which houses the Chief Minister’s office, as a protests gesture against the civilian killing during police and Central Reserve Police Force (CRPF) action since June 11.

Peoples Democratic Party Legislators led by their party president Mehbooba Mufti today locked the main entrance of civil secretariat of Srinagar and sat on a dharna. This was to give the government a taste of the siege which it has laid around every citizen of Kashmir.

Holding placards to highlight the atrocities on women, children and general public the legislators demanded dismantling of repressive arrangements in place to muzzle the voice of people.

The PDP President Mehbooba Mufti while speaking to the media persons said government had let loose a reign of terror and by its own account as many as 14oo teen agers have been arrested, even as the actual figure is much larger. She said the continued undeclared curfew and inhuman restrictions have converted the whole valley into a large prison. Demanding the immediate release of all the innocent persons Mehbooba said the government seems to be at war with its own people and it had lost all credibility and moral authority. The undue restrictions she said had brought life to a standstill and economic despair to entire society especially the weaker and the vulnerable sections. She said even though the community had responded to needs of poor the government did not even allow the relief goods to reach those in need of them.

Expressing the solidarity of her party with the people Mehbooba said that all the organizational units will contribute their mite to the relief effort and help in saving the poor from starvation. Mehbooba said the government should lift the restrictions and release all the detainees before the holy month of Ramdhan.
